Coding Time Tracker for Steam tracks the time you spend programming in IDEs like Visual Studio, VSCode, and JetBrains. It automatically logs your coding activity as Steam game time, closes the game window when using an IDE, and supports multiple languages. It runs on Windows and integrates with Steam to display your coding activity.
The program records your time spent working in various IDEs and automatically transfers it to Kode Studio.
When you launch any supported IDE, the program automatically starts Kode Studio via Steam without the need for manual intervention.
Once you close the IDE or code editor, Kode Studio automatically shuts down, ending the game activity on Steam.
The Kode Studio game window is automatically hidden while you are working in the code editor, so it does not distract you from programming.
All the information about the time spent programming is displayed directly on your Steam profile.
The program supports multiple languages, including Russian, English, Spanish, German, French, and Italian.
